Darren Waller scores two touchdowns vs. Jets

Darren Waller is lighting up the Jets in Week 13.

Update — Waller caught three more passes and finished with 13 receptions for 200 yards and two scores in the Raiders’ 31-28 win.

Las Vegas Raiders tight end Darren Waller has been one of the best tight ends in the NFL all season and is having his best game of the year against the New York Jets. Derek Carr’s top target has hauled in 10 passes for 151 yards and two scores against the winless Jets through three quarters and some change. The Raiders hold a 24-13 lead heading in the final frame, so there’s a chance Waller could pad his stats more before the final whistle.

The Kansas City Chiefs’ Travis Kelce is the only tight end in the NFL with more targets, receptions, and receiving yards than Waller. Wallers ranks second in all three categories and remains the top pass catcher in Las Vegas.
